10 Day Fast


So.

For my 10 Day Fast over at the Apothecary Circle I am taking a break from social media. Especially on my phone. When I first wake up, I lay in bed for an hour or so just browsing on my phone. I end up skipping breakfast and running out the door rushing to work. A lot of my time and energy revolve around these apps!

And I end up browsing and spend waayyy too much online. So I need to take this break, however uncomfortable it will make me feel.

What will this look like?
~Erasing my apps on the phone.
~Only checking my email up to 3 times a day.
~Keep my monitor off at work unless I need to use my work files
~Keep a list of alternative things I can do instead.

With this Fast, I am inviting space for more energy, productivity, and nourishing activities. Here is my list of alternatives (in no particular order):
~Yoga
~Read
~Crochet 
~Phone dates/ in-person dates with friends
~Make some herbal goodness!
~Organize our place
~Work on my workshops and other Moondaughter offerings
~More dates with my boy
~Take a shower
~Make my own spa/facial
~Clean make up brushes
~Journal more
~Spend more time out in nature
~Meditate
~Moon magic
~Paint my nails
~Workout
